Still have yet to try the regimen. Does the regimen treat comedonal acne as well? I've broken out with white heads all on the sides of my checks & jaw. Like literally every pore. The only thing getting rid of some of it is extractions but who has time to sit here & extract hundreds of white heads right? I used that yes to tomatoes soap over a month ago & thats what caused this. I should have know better.I'm assuming my skin was just purging but now I'm stuck with this crap. I get it off & on on my forehead too but I can usually get rid of it. My forehead which is my problem area is clear btw so I know it wasn't my hormones that caused this. Any help would be greatly appreciated. I'm getting married in a few months & I just want clear skin & to look & feel pretty.

You should buy the AHA creme from acne.org and use it at night time, and maybe also BP.

The best combo for you would be Benozyl peroxide and after that using AHA creme on top of that. It will exfoliates and kill the bacterias and it will work quickly.

Another more quick-fix option is to do lactic acid peels, you can do some lactic acid peels (25% for your case) weekly and then apply a good moisturizer after the treatments.

Not at all. There is plenty of time to September 22nd. AHA and BP are the two most effective products for breakouts.

Try using the AHA creme and BP gel as a spot treatment at first (at night) and you'll see it clears up breakouts.
